Crommium willemettii

Gastropoda - Naticidae

Taxonomy
Ampullaria willemettii was named by Deshayes (1825) [DISTRIBUTION: Eocene; England.]. It is not a trace fossil. It is the type species of Crommium.

It was recombined as Crommium willemettii by Majima (1989).
